Why Most 'Scam Prevention' Fails
Many projects claim to be safe but rely on vague promises or influencer marketing alone. Real scam prevention is structural. It's coded into the token's mechanics and visible in the project's assets. A common failure point is the lack of a sustainable revenue model for creators, which pressures them to exit via a rug pull. Another is the absence of a legitimate, owned web presence, forcing communication through ephemeral Telegram groups or tweets that can be deleted.
For example, a token launched on a platform with 0% creator fees has no built-in incentive for the creator to maintain the project after the initial launch hype. Their only monetization is selling their own token supply. This misalignment of interests is a primary red flag. Your strategy must address these structural weaknesses from day one.

After your token grows and "graduates" from the initial launch pool, you can upgrade it to Solana's Token-2022 standard. This allows you to enforce a 1% fee on all transfers. This perpetual, protocol-level fee provides guaranteed, decentralized revenue to a defined treasury wallet. This funds long-term development and operations, removing the financial pressure for a creator to "rug pull" or abandon the project.
